Current ensemble forecasts from the National Weather Service and GFS models indicate limited overnight radiational cooling under a warm, humid southerly flow with scattered thunderstorms and cloud cover, positioning the 78-79°F range as the leading market-implied outcome at 41.5% for Atlanta’s daily minimum on August 27. This aligns with recent observations of persistent high dew points and weak pressure gradients across the Southeast that suppress typical nocturnal drops. Late-August climatology shows average lows near 71°F, yet model consensus clusters probabilities around 70-75°F bins amid forecast uncertainty in exact timing of any clearing. Traders will monitor updated NWS guidance and local mesonet data for shifts before resolution.

The resolution source for this market will be information from NOAA, specifically the lowest reading under the "Temp" column for all times on this day, available here: https://www.weather.gov/wrh/timeseries?site=katl
This market will resolve off of the Hourly Data provided using the "Show Hourly Data" button.
If NOAA data is unavailable or missing for the observation period, Weather Underground will be used as the secondary resolution source.
To toggle between Fahrenheit and Celsius, click the "Switch to US Units w/ kts" button until the relevant table displays °F.
This market can not resolve until the first data point for the following date has been published on the resolution source.
The resolution source for this market measures temperatures to whole degrees Fahrenheit (eg, 21°F). Thus, this is the level of precision that will be used when resolving the market.
Revisions to temperatures recorded within this market's timeframe will be considered until the first datapoint for the following date has been published, after which any alterations will not be considered.
